This paper investigates a diagnostic method and a fault-tolerant control strategy (FTCS) for the short-circuit fault (SCF) of IGBTs in the dual three-phase permanent magnet synchronous motor (DTP-PMSM) drive system. At first, the method based on bus current detection is used to determine whether a SCF occurs. Next, a positioning procedure based on logical analysis and local circuit currents is further proposed to determine the precise position of the faulty IGBT. Then, with the aim of reducing torque ripple, an improved FTCS is proposed. Finally, the effectiveness of the proposed diagnostic method and FTCS is verified through simulation experiments.
